Understanding the Role of Boiler/Heating Engineers

Boiler and heating engineers play a crucial role in ensuring our homes and businesses remain warm and comfortable. These professionals are respon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ing heating systems, which include boilers, radiators, and underfloor heating. In Diss, a picturesque town in Norfolk, the demand for skilled boiler/heating engineers is ever-present, especially during the chilly months.

Heating engineers possess a wealth of knowledge about different types of heating systems and the latest technologies. They are adept at diagnosing issues, recommending solutions, and ensuring systems operate efficiently and safely. Their expertise is vital in both residential and commercial settings, where heating systems are essential for comfort and productivity.

The Importance of Hiring Qualified Engineers

When it comes to heating systems, hiring a qualified engineer is paramount. Qualified engineers have undergone rigorous training and possess certifications that attest to their skills and knowledge. In the UK, Gas Safe registration is a legal requirement for anyone working with gas appliances, ensuring safety and compliance with regulations.

Qualified engineers not only guarantee the safety of your heating system but also enhance its efficiency. An efficient system reduces energy consumption, leading to lower utility bills and a reduced carbon footprint. Moreover, professional engineers can provide valuable advice on system upgrades and energy-saving measures.

Common Services Offered by Heating Engineers

Boiler/heating engineers in Diss offer a wide range of services to meet the diverse needs of their clients. These services include:

  • Installation: Engineers install new boilers and heating systems, ensuring they are correctly set up and integrated with existing infrastructure.
  • Maintenance: Regular maintenance checks are crucial for the longevity and efficiency of heating systems. Engineers perform inspections, clean components, and replace worn parts.
  • Repairs: When systems malfunction, engineers diagnose and repair issues promptly to restore functionality.
  • Upgrades: Engineers advise on and implement system upgrades, such as installing smart thermostats or more efficient boilers.

Understanding Boiler Types and Their Maintenance

Boilers come in various types, each with unique features and maintenance requirements. Understanding these differences can help you choose the right system for your needs and ensure it remains in optimal condition.

Combi Boilers

Combi boilers are popular in Diss due to their compact size and efficiency. They provide both heating and hot water without the need for a separate water tank, making them ideal for smaller homes. Regular maintenance includes checking the pressure, cleaning the heat exchanger, and ensuring the flue is clear.

System Boilers

System boilers are suitable for homes with higher hot water demands. They require a separate hot water cylinder but no cold water tank, making them more efficient than traditional boilers. Maintenance involves inspecting the cylinder, checking for leaks, and ensuring the system is balanced.

Regular Boilers

Also known as conventional boilers, regular boilers are best for homes with traditional heating systems. They require both a hot water cylinder and a cold water tank. Maintenance includes checking the tanks for leaks, inspecting the boiler for corrosion, and ensuring the system is free of airlocks.

Energy Efficiency and Environmental Impact

Energy efficiency is a key consideration when choosing a heating system. Efficient systems not only reduce energy bills but also minimise environmental impact. Boiler/heating engineers in Diss can advise on the most efficient systems and practices.

Upgrading to Energy-Efficient Systems

Upgrading to an energy-efficient boiler can significantly reduce energy consumption. Modern boilers are designed to maximise efficiency, with features such as condensing technology and smart controls. Engineers can assess your current system and recommend suitable upgrades.

Implementing Smart Heating Solutions

Smart heating solutions, such as programmable thermostats and smart meters, allow for greater control over heating systems. These technologies enable users to schedule heating, monitor energy usage, and adjust settings remotely, leading to improved efficiency and comfort.

Reducing Carbon Footprint

By choosing energy-efficient systems and practices, homeowners can reduce their carbon footprint. Engineers can provide advice on renewable energy options, such as solar panels or heat pumps, which further decrease reliance on fossil fuels.

Frequently Asked Questions

  1. What qualifications should a boiler/heating engineer have? Engineers should be Gas Safe registered and have relevant certifications in heating systems.
  2. How often should I service my boiler? It's recommended to service your boiler annually to ensure efficiency and safety.
  3. What are the signs of a faulty boiler? Common signs include unusual noises, leaks, and inconsistent heating.
  4. Can I install a boiler myself? No, boiler installation should be carried out by a qualified engineer to ensure safety and compliance.
  5. How can I improve my heating system's efficiency? Regular maintenance, upgrading to a modern boiler, and using smart controls can enhance efficiency.
  6. What should I do if my boiler breaks down? Contact a qualified heating engineer to diagnose and repair the issue promptly.
